混合酸溶ICP-AES测试碳酸盐岩石中硼元素  被引量:3

Determination of Boron in Carbonate Rocks by Mixed Acid Dissolution ICP-AES

摘  要:混合酸溶,以磷酸固定硼元素,盐酸、硝酸、氢氟酸、高氯酸混合酸溶,碱化样品,分离铁干扰,以ICP-AES测试,建立碳酸盐中硼元素的测试方法。当溶样系数是100时,硼的检出限为1 mg/kg,定量限为4 mg/kg;线性范围为0.05~50 mg/L;线性相关系数为1.000;将该法应用到碳酸盐中硼元素的分析,其加标回收率为94.6%~106.2%;相对标准偏差为0.21%~0.86%;该方法克服了垂直电极-发射光谱法测试碳酸中的样品容易飞溅,样品的准确度和精确度不足等问题,适合大批量样品的分析测试。Mixed acid dissolution,fixed boron with phosphoric acid,mixed acid dissolution with hydrochloric acid,nitric acid,hydrofluoric acid and perchloric acid,alkalization of samples,separation of iron interference,and ICP-AES test to establish a test method for boron in carbonate.When the sample dissolution coefficient is 100,the detection limit of boron is 1 mg/kg,and the quantitative limit is 4 mg/kg.The linear range is 0.05~50 mg/L.The linear correlation coefficient is 1.000.The method was applied to the analysis of boron in carbonate,and the recovery rate was 94.6%~106.2%.The relative standard deviation is 0.21%~0.86%.This method overcomes the problems of sample splashing in the test of carbonic acid by vertical electrode-emission spectrometry,and the lack of accuracy and accuracy of samples,and is suitable for the analysis and test of large quantities of samples.
